Organizational communication

Organizational communication (or Organizational Communication ) is a subject of research in the cutting area of communication science ( particularly PR - research) and organizational theory and refers to the internal and external communication processes of organizations. Organizational communication is thus generally understood as communication, as well as the communication of organizations. Does organizational communication on the organizational form of enterprises, it is also spoken of corporate communications. Other organizational communication types are eg Association of Communications, NGO communications and party communication.

Term and definition

Concept understanding in science

The term is used differently in the literature; Basis for the understanding of the term include Theis - Berglmair (1994) and Herger (2004) to find. Communication in organizations covers all internal communications, ie for example teamwork or decision making processes. The communication of organizations covering all external communications. Referring to the theory of organization is subordinated as part of the public relations of the organization communication. Here, the research interest is, for example, on the formative influence of organizations on topic selection and preparation on the part of the mass media (see determination hypothesis ).

Technical media can play a role in the communication processes. Organizational communication as a field of research does not necessarily only the communication, by or even for organizations in the institutional sense of focus, but can be understood as a dynamic communication -understood organization ideas, reflected for example in different forms of organizational models or organizational concepts.

The term organizational communication is also used in the narrow sense of public relations, public relations or in the sense of integrated corporate communication, but to pick out the part only specific aspects of the general concept. From the perspective of communication studies organizational communication is a type of communication on the level of public next individual, group and mass communication.

Understanding of the term in professional practice

From the perspective of practice, organizational communication is often equated with networked, integrated communications and refers to the communication of an organization to which the various communication disciplines such as PR, marketing, advertising, corporate identity, etc., in an entire concept brought coordinated with each other and coordinated be. This point of view - although comprehensive - represents a significant narrowing of the concept and is only justified by its practical use background.
